Title :
Optimal FFT architecture selection for OFDM receivers on FPGA

Abstract :
This paper deals with the development of reusable FFT cores for OFDM in the light of the new features offered by modern FPGAs and synthesis tools. A pipelined and a sequential architecture have been selected as case studies to show how the requirements of various OFDM standards affect the choice of the optimal FFT architecture
